Inspiration
We saw so many job seekers spending months preparing for roles without knowing exactly which skills matter most for their target job. Most online learning resources are generic and don’t prioritize based on individual gaps. This inspired us to build SkillBridge — a tool that bridges the gap between your current skills and your career goals in the shortest possible time.
What it does
SkillBridge instantly: Analyzes your current skills and resume. Compares them with industry-standard skill requirements for your chosen role. Highlights missing skills. Generates a personalized 30-day microlearning plan with free resources. Provides real-world success stories for motivation.
How we built it
Data Gathering – Collected role-specific skill data from job postings, professional networks, and open datasets. Skill Gap Detection – Implemented NLP-based matching to compare user-provided skills with role requirements. Prioritization Algorithm – Ranked missing skills based on frequency in job postings and industry relevance. Learning Plan Generator – Created an automated plan that breaks learning into daily, focused tasks. Frontend – Built an interactive UI using Streamlit for instant results. Backend – Used Python, pandas, and scikit-learn for data processing; hosted via cloud deployment.
Challenges we ran into
Mapping vague skill names from resumes to standardized skill sets. Ensuring the microplan stayed practical and not overwhelming. Creating engaging real-world stories for 20+ different roles. Managing data inconsistencies from various job listing sources.
Accomplishments that we're proud of
Built a fully working prototype in a short timeframe. Automated skill-gap analysis for 20 different career roles. Created a dynamic story engine that changes based on the chosen role. Received positive feedback from early testers who said it’s exactly what they needed.
What we learned
How to design personalized learning pathways using skill prioritization. Improved our NLP skills for text matching and similarity scoring. The importance of UI simplicity when guiding users through a complex analysis. How crucial storytelling is for motivating learners to take action.
What's next for SkillBridge — AI Job Skill Gap Finder
Add AI resume parsing to auto-detect skills without manual input. Integrate with LinkedIn and GitHub to fetch real-time user profiles. Expand database to 100+ roles with verified skill requirements. Gamify the learning plan with progress tracking and rewards. Partner with online learning platforms to recommend targeted courses.
Built With
- artificial-intelligence
- csv
- data-analysis
- data-science
- json
- machine-learning
- nltk
- numpy
- pandas
- python
- scikit-learn
- spacy
- streamlit
Log in or sign up for Devpost to join the conversation.